Driver-partner agreement

Eligibility and vehicle requirements

You must be legally eligible to drive, provide truthful identity and contact details, complete the required KYC and background checks, and keep your licence, insurance, permit, fitness, PUC and other vehicle records valid. The vehicle must meet Chale's category and age requirements and be owned or authorised for your use.

Fares, commission and settlements

Chale calculates fares from the published rate card and shows the applicable breakdown before booking. Commission, incentives, tolls, taxes, refunds and cancellation charges are recorded in the ride ledger. Driver settlements are generated from traceable ledger entries and paid only after an authorised payout confirmation.

Suspension, fraud and accidents

Chale may pause dispatch while a document is expired, an incident is investigated, a safety condition is unresolved, or fraud signals require review. Report collisions, injury, theft and material vehicle damage to Chale and your insurer immediately. A suspension or deactivation decision includes a reason and a support/dispute path.

Insurance, privacy and disputes

You remain responsible for legally required vehicle, passenger and personal-accident coverage unless Chale separately confirms an additional policy. Chale processes driver data under its privacy policy, keeps verification evidence protected, and records agreement versions and material decisions. Questions or disputes can be raised through complaints & grievances.
